# Nowah vs Wanderlog

A travel agent or a collaborative planning workspace?

Wanderlog is a strong visual planner for routes, lists, reservations, budgets, and group collaboration, and it includes an AI assistant. Nowah is the better fit when you want the planner to also search, book, and handle the operational trip work.

*Reviewed: July 2026*

**Nowah is best for:** You want to ask for the outcome and have an agent turn it into live options, bookings, documents, tracking, and next actions.

**Wanderlog is best for:** You enjoy building the itinerary yourself, need real-time collaboration, or care deeply about road-trip routes, budgets, checklists, and shared lists.

## Comparison

| Area | Nowah | Wanderlog |
| --- | --- | --- |
| Best at | Agent-led planning and action | Collaborative itinerary building |
| How you start | Conversation, link, or screenshot | Create a trip, add places, import bookings, or use AI |
| Planning | Generated and conversationally refined itineraries | Hands-on route, list, schedule, and map editing |
| Booking | Flights, stays, and experiences | Reservation organization and accommodation comparison links |
| During the trip | Live agent and trip operations | Offline plans, flight updates, maps, budgets, and collaboration |

## Wanderlog strengths

- Excellent collaborative itinerary editing
- Strong map, route, budget, and checklist tools
- Reservation import, offline access, and group planning
